Empress Elisabeth of Austria - a tea set,
silver, partly inner gilding, consisting of: teapot, milk jug and sugar bowl, of round form, straight drapery, hinged lid with sculptural floral finial, ivory handle, each with 4 feet, all pieces with engraved monogram "E" with Austrian imperial crown, height of teapot 16.5 cm, diameter of sugar bowl 17.5 cm, total gross weight 1505 g, master’s mark M & K = Stephan Mayerhofer and Klinkosch, old Viennese hallmark 1849/50, (Lu)
A magnificent personal tea set from the property of Empress Elisabeth, manufactured by the Purveyors to the Imperial and Royal Chamber Stephan Mayerhofer and Klinkosch. The tea set, along with the so-called “Elisabeth silver” in the former Court Silver and Table Chamber, was probably among the private purchases of imperial family. In this case, too, the imperial family resorted to the famous Court Purveyors Mayerhofer & Klinkosch. An identical tea set (with additional hot water kettle and rechaud) was offered and sold at last year’s auction of Imperial court memorabilia (Dorotheum catalogue, Imperial court memorabilia, auction of 18 June 2019, cat. no. 121). The present tea set has the same provenance and belongs to the tea set sold then.
Lit.:
Former Court Silver and Table Chamber, catalogue of the collection, vol. I, ed. by Ilsebill Barta-Fliedl, Peter Parenzan, Vienna 1996, cat no. 163. Sale Dorotheum, Imperial court memorabilia, 18 June 2019, cat. no. 121.
Provenance:
House of Habsburg.
